The cheapest way to get from East Grinstead to Torquay is to bus which costs £40 - £110 and takes 8h 23m.
The fastest way to get from East Grinstead to Torquay is to drive which takes 3h 40m and costs £50 - £75.
No, there is no direct bus from East Grinstead to Torquay. However, there are services departing from War Memorial and arriving at Cary Parade via South Terminal Bus Station, Heathrow Central Bus Station and Rail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 23m.
No, there is no direct train from East Grinstead to Torquay. However, there are services departing from East Grinstead and arriving at Newton Abbot via Victoria station and London Paddington.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 9m.
The distance between East Grinstead and Torquay is 234 miles. The road distance is 207.5 miles.
The best way to get from East Grinstead to Torquay without a car is to train which takes 5h 9m and costs £100 - £210.
It takes approximately 5h 9m to get from East Grinstead to Torquay, including transfers.
East Grinstead to Torquay bus services, operated by National Express, depart from South Terminal Bus Station.
East Grinstead to Torquay train services, operated by Southern, depart from East Grinstead station.
The best way to get from East Grinstead to Torquay is to train which takes 5h 9m and costs £100 - £210.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£40 - £110 and takes 8h 23m.
